Output 64834507107d4b7a013d186568d07e3f698a63256b0e5a447f5c2cacce47b36a:0

value
3818125443
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e68b26f04d75b8182c3c6f43ae5c0ffd80b0eda3 OP_EQUAL
address
2NEGE6rzD1ZyhFWgfhTN8Y7GsEcmcqbFXkR
transaction
64834507107d4b7a013d186568d07e3f698a63256b0e5a447f5c2cacce47b36a